The Druze Dilemma: A Community in Turmoil
The Druze community, which straddles the border between Israel and Syria, is more than a pawn in a geopolitical chess game. Historically marginalized, the Druze seek recognition and rights in both countries. Al-Shar’s pledge to safeguard the Druze reflects a broader urgency within Syria to unify and assert control against external threats. However, conflicting narratives within this community illustrate their lack of monolithic representation and the nuanced positions held by various factions.
A Calculated Strategy: The Quest for Land
Many experts posit that Israeli incursions extend beyond immediate security concerns for the Druze. Instead, they may symbolize efforts to expand territorial claims in the region, particularly in southern Syria, a strategically valuable area. This ambition aligns with Israel’s long-standing aspirations for greater territorial control, posing serious implications for the region's stability.
